你查询的IP:[59.191.2.163]  地理位置:中国–广东

最新查询61.28.186.10 119.164.56.70 58.24.83.122 123.64.6.172 58.32.169.10 119.10.32.12 120.94.1.192 210.2.11.244 161.207.246.68 59.191.2.163 123.52.197.87 202.41.152.112 218.56.207.48 202.92.252.11 202.179.240.146 203.174.96.212 116.13.207.206 210.32.1.57 210.82.134.69 123.244.12.51 124.240.236.94 202.38.140.140 114.68.222.55 117.21.116.79 202.122.128.215 221.192.118.228 220.160.253.101 60.232.231.24 124.172.41.209 117.124.28.103 124.160.50.124